WebSugar gliders exhibit stereotypical behaviors that help them survive as prey animals and as colony members. Therefore, sugar gliders tend to be fearful in the presence of strange … Web16 Aug 2024 · Sugar gliders are arboreal so they like to climb and jump from place to place. They don't want to run around on the ground. They feel safe up high so they may immediately crawl up your arm, hide at the nape of your neck, or perch on the top of your head (hopefully they don't decide to urine mark you here).
